Danny Love's Farrier's Corner


Correct Horseshoeing
Part Five

Danny checks to make sure there is no pressure in the sole area by inserting a measuring blade.
This is the appropriate amount of reach for the measuring blade.
The hoof is rasped below the nail points in order to accomodate the clinches. Irregularities and scale on the face of the hoof are also cleaned up at this time.
